Overview Vytilla HB Rose Syrup
Rose Syrup Vytilla HB is a dietary supplement providing folic acid. This supplement addresses anemia stemming from folic acid deficiency, a condition characterized by insufficient red blood cells. Red blood cell production, crucial for oxygen transport throughout the body, relies on folic acid. Vytilla HB Rose Syrup can be consumed with or without food; consistent daily dosing at the same time maximizes efficacy. Swallow the syrup whole; do not crush, chew, or break it. Dosage is determined by your physician based on your condition's severity. A balanced diet rich in folic acid, iron, vitamins, and minerals is also beneficial. This medication generally exhibits excellent tolerability with minimal side effects. However, some individuals may experience bloating, gas, nausea, or weight loss. Regular blood tests to monitor blood cell counts, iron levels, treatment progress, and potential side effects may be necessary. Prior to commencing treatment, inform your doctor of any pre-existing conditions like rheumatoid arthritis, asthma, allergies, or hypertension, as well as all other medications you are currently using. Reducing alcohol intake during treatment is recommended.

How Vytilla HB Rose Syrup works:
Rose Syrup Vytilla HB is a vitamin B supplement crucial for red blood cell production, enabling efficient oxygen transport. Its importance extends to pregnancy, supporting healthy fetal brain and spinal cord development.
